Every person who becomes addicted to drugs or alcohol has a unique story as to how they got there. They may have gotten addicted to prescription pain medication after an injury or tried cocaine at a party or started drinking socially and progressed until it was an everyday habit. However, no matter how someone became an addict or an alcoholic the very first step they’ll take when they decide to stop drinking or using is to go through detoxification.

Detoxifying from dependency on stimulants: Withdrawal from stimulants such as cocaine, methamphetamine and Ritalin can come with feelings of depression, agitation and extreme craving.
